WebA baby with hydrocephalus has extra c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) around the brain. The baby's head may look larger than normal. This is a rare condition. A healthcare provider may diagnose this condition during an ultrasound in pregnancy. The goal of treatment is to reduce the pressure inside your baby's head. This is done by draining the fluid or ... Urgent indications for lumbar puncture include … WebJan 31, 2024 · Lumbar puncture (LP) may be considered one of the most well-known diagnostic procedures in the field of pediatric infectious diseases. It is an essential procedure for analyzing c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) in the evaluation for meningitis, sepsis, fever, or subarachnoid hemorrhage (SAH) in neonates. Advertisement. 2.
